-How do I freeze a page in Suite 2?
I used the F12 key in Suite 1, and now I don't know how to use the freeze option with a key.

-How do I assign a key to a scene or switch? In suite 1, i used Ctrl + KEY, is there such a way in Suite 2? I know how assign a key in Settings - Trigger, but i would like to know if there's a faster way like in Suite 1.

-I liked to change the Phase of a Scene using the keys Ctrl+shift+Scene. But now it doesn't work. Is there a way to change the phase of a scene with keys?

-How do I assign a key to a scene or switch?
shift + right klick -> "Link to Keyboard" and then press the key you want to get linked.
And in the manual -> http://www.nicolaudie.com/online_manual ... dfPgY7.htm
eg the Flash mode can be changed in the shift + klick -> Settings -> Triggering later on.

For MIDI it is the same way. Plus that i recommand for Midi going to the consol window to check/changes settings for the Relevant Buttons there.
Eg i assining a Fader as Scene Dimmer and to activate a Scene. Once done i you need to adjust the level for activation so that the Scene becomes aktive from 1-127 (straight when you start moving the Fader) and to do this you need the Consol Window showing your consol (Right klickt on the relevant Fader/Button)
-I liked to change the Phase of a Scene using the keys Ctrl+shift+Scene. But now it doesn't work. Is there a way to change the phase of a scene with keys?
- When a Scene is aktive on the page top there is a tab showing the Phase/Speed/Dimm/Size
- shift+right and then show eg the Phase dial. It is shown on the Scene Button then.
- shift - click on a Button show a seperate small window with teh Dials.

-How do I freeze a page in Suite 2?
You can freeze a page by checking the Freeze checkbox on the pages panel. This is the 3rd checkbox along next to the lock checkbox
You can link this to the console by right clicking the page on the pages panel and selecting Link to console->page freeze
You should be able to assign a keyboard shortcut to this by going to Software Preferences->shortcuts, however it appears that we have forgotten to add this, it will be available in the next beta next week
-How do I assign a key to a scene or switch?
Shift+Right click-> link to keyboard. There is a reason we had to scrap the old method...but I can't remember right now!
there a way to change the phase of a scene with keys?
This is now done by adding a phase dial. This can be linked to the console
